GRF is the longest established Christian broadcasting organisation in Britain.

In November 2008 GRF marks 60 years of continuous production of Christian radio programmes. To celebrate this milestone, GRF is holding two events:

Founded in 1948, GRF has always been a producer, making radio programmes for other people to transmit. GRF produces a wide range of programmes for stations in Britian and worldwide.

GRF's role is one of partnership - making programmes which complement the exisiting programme schedules of a wide range of stations, both mainstream and Christian.

In this role, GRF has supplied programmes to:

  • International Christian radio stations since 1948;
  • Hospital Radio since 1964;
  • Commercial Radio in the UK since 1973
  • Various overseas local radio stations since 1987;
  • BBC Radio since 1989;
  • Community Radio since 1990; and
  • Restricted Service Licence stations (RSLs) since 1992;
  • Internet Distribution (Audiopot) since 2001

GRF has supplied programmes to more than 150 radio stations worldwide. New partnerships are formed every year.

GRF is a charity and our programmes are all made by an interdenominational team of volunteers working in the evenings and at weekends.
